 Introducing Myles Kennedy’s first signature model. Known for his work in Alter Bridge, Slash and the Conspirators, and his own solo recordings, Kennedy is an accomplished guitarist who brings blues and jazz style to rock guitar playing. This new signature model mirrors Kennedy’s rock sensibilities with a nod to historic designs. While the aesthetic may have players hearing chicken pickin’ in their heads – and this guitar can certainly reach twang territory – it is made to play like a rock machine.

“This guitar captures the spirit of my favorite older instruments. With that said, since we developed this guitar, most of my vintage instruments rarely see the light of day,” said Kennedy.

The PRS Myles Kennedy signature guitar features a swamp ash body, a 22-fret, 25.5” scale length maple neck with maple fretboard, and two PRS Narrowfield MK pickups. The PRS Narrowfield MK pickups were carefully voiced to capture the courage of humbuckers and the spank of single coils. PRS Narrowfields provided the perfect starting point for this design, with their ability to deliver thick single-coil sounds without the hum. These pickups are paired with a 5-way blade switch and a push/pull tone control that acts as a preset tone rolloff, bringing down the higher frequencies on the treble pickup so you can dig in to the fullest.

“I watched Myles throughout his career alternate between humbucking and single coil sounds without giving anything up on either side. These pickups took us months to dial in, and I think they capture that balance that Myles mastered beautifully,” said Paul Reed Smith.

Other features include a PRS plate-style steel bridge, vintage-style locking tuners, bone nut, and Kennedy’s “Geometric Owl” logo from his “Ides of March” solo release,  representing wisdom and adaptability.

“I feel like we managed to touch on the elusive quality that makes you want to play with this guitar. It beckons you to take it off the wall or out of the case and make music.” – Myles Kennedy

Specs
BODY
Body Construction Solidbody
Body Wood Swamp Ash
Top Carve Flat Top
NECK
Number of Frets 22
Scale Length 25.5”
Neck Wood Maple
Neck Construction Scarfed
Truss Rod PRS Double-Acting
Neck Shape Myles Kennedy
Neck Depth at 1/2 Fret 57/64” [22.62 mm]
Neck Depth at 12 1/2 Fret 31/32” [24.58 mm]
Width of Fretboard at the Nut 1 41/64” [41.67mm]
Width of Fretboard at the Body 2 15/64” [56.75 mm]
Fretboard Wood Maple
Fretboard Radius 10”
Fretboard Inlay Birds
Headstock Logo Signature, Decal
NECK/BODY ASSEMBLY
NBA Type Bolt-On
HARDWARE
Bridge PRS Plate Style, Steel
Tuners Vintage Style, Locking
Hardware Type Nickel
Nut Bone
Truss Rod Cover Myles Kennedy “Geometric Owl” Logo
ELECTRONICS
Treble Pickup Narrowfield MK
Bass Pickup Narrowfield MK
Controls Volume and Push/Pull Tone Control with 5-Way Blade Pickup Switch
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
Strings PRS Signature 10-46
Tuning Standard (6 String): E, A, D, G, B, E
Case Premium Gig Bag
FINISHES
Antique White*, Black*, Hunters Green*, Tri-Color Sunburst, Vintage Natural
*Opaque Finish
ELECTRONICS EXPLANATION FOR CONTROL DIAGRAM
P1 (Switch Down) Treble Humbucker
P2 Treble Humbucker & Bass Coil Split
P3 Treble & Bass Humbuckers
P4 Treble & Bass Coil Split
P5 (Switch Up) Bass Humbucker
Push/Pull Acts as a preset tone roll off for the treble pickup, bringing the higher frequencies down to slightly darken the tone. Active in positions 1-4.
